Synopsis
Paris, 1960. Jean-Louis lives a bourgeois existence absorbed in his work, cohabiting peacefully with his neurotic socialite wife Suzanne while their children are away at boarding school. The couple’s world is turned upside-down when they hire a Spanish maid Maria. Through Maria, Jean-Louis is introduced to an alternative reality just a few floors up on the building’s sixth floor, the servants’ quarters. He befriends a group of sassy Spanish maids, refugees of the Franco regime, who teach him there’s more to life than stocks and bonds, and whose influence on the house will ultimately transform everyone’s life.
